"Abram was eighty-six years old when Ishmael was born.”
Genesis 16:16
“When Abram was ninety-nine years old, the Lord appeared to him and said,
‘I am El-Shaddai—God Almighty. Serve me faithfully and live a blameless life.’”
Genesis 17:1
It had been thirteen long years since Abram and Sarai had tried to create a miracle on their own. Now at ninety-nine years of age, Abram was still without God’s promised son. The couple was left wondering if they had destroyed His blessing on their lives. Why had God been so silent?
In reality, God was preparing Abram for a new revelation. Up to that point, Abram had only known God as Elohim (Creator) or Jehovah Elyon (God Most High). However, in the next chapter God disclosed another part of Himself, “I am El-Shaddai, God Almighty.” In other words, his God was ALL-powerful and ALL-sufficient! What a stunning truth for Abram to hear after years of focusing on the impossibilities of old age. Now he learned that God Almighty is not bound by laws of nature. Nothing could stop His promises!
God employs the difficult seasons in our lives to give us a fresh revelation of Himself. The years of waiting on the impossible may seem like an eternity, but when the page turns, there HE is…handing us a fresh glimpse of His character. These precious revelations shine the brightest in the dark times, and thankfully they can lead us on with renewed faith to a new chapter!
